Handover Note — Second-Source Supplier Search

From: R. Casten, to: L. Ibarra (cc: finance)

Status: three candidate suppliers shortlisted for the Novadrive housing. Site audits done for two; third pending. Quotes land within 8% of incumbent. Budget line already approved. Decision needed by month-end to hit tooling lead times. Strategic context follows.

management briefing: The renewal with Zoraelax Group closes at $10 million a year, 15 percent below the last contract. Project Ralael slips by six weeks because of the audit delay.

Handover: Exportron retry queue

Hi Mira — handing over the failed-export retries. Exports that hit a timeout land in the retry queue and get three attempts with backoff; after that they're parked and need a manual requeue from the admin panel. Watch for customers reporting duplicates — that usually means a double requeue. The current retry settings are as follows.

settings of bajog-fawig:
oliael:
  log_level: warn
  metrics_host: metrics.oliael.zemvarsys.internal
  pin: 0267
  pool_size: 32

Minutes — Management Meeting

Prepared for the incoming director. Topic: possible acquisition of Greyfen Analytics. Due diligence 70% complete. Valuation gap remains; Greyfen seeks a premium. Integration risks flagged by Ops. Decision deferred to next month. Talla Nyberg leads negotiations. Our walk-away position is stated below.

board note of fawig-kagup: Only 48 of the 435 pilot accounts renewed Rusion, so a churn review is set for September 12. Fenwynox Logistics is in early talks to buy Sorielek Systems for about $117.8 million.